Sedalia Police reports 2-16-18

Callie M. Hall, 18, Holden, was arrested by Sedalia Police for DWI at 1:10 a.m. Friday at Broadway and Engineer. Hall was transported to the Pettis County Jail, booked and released with a March 14 court date.


On Thursday afternoon, a resident in the 2400 block of Golf Drive reported finding a knife near her home. According to a report, the knife could possibly belong to a prowler seen at Skyline Elementary School the day before (Wednesday). The knife, described as a Yoshi Blade kitchen knife, was placed into evidence by police.


 

On Thursday afternoon, WalMart reported the theft of $49.97 of items from the store by a female known to asset protection. She allegedly left without paying. The suspect has not yet been located.


 

On Thursday evening, Sedalia Police took a hit-and-run report that occurred at Broadway and Curry Drive. According to the report, the caller approached the intersection in his car shortly after 4 p.m. and noticed a car was stopped at a green light. The caller attempted to stop, but struck the vehicle. The vehicle then left the area without proving any information.


 

On Thursday night, Sedalia Police took a theft report of a cell hone from inside a business at 715 E. Broadway. According to the report, the victim named a suspect, but they have not yet been located.


 

On Thursday night, a resident in the 3100 block of Wing Avenue reported the theft of a vehicle that occurred around 8:50 p.m. According to a report, keys to the vehicle were taken from the kitchen counter by a visitor. The suspect left shortly before the victim noticed his car was missing.


 

On Wednesday, Sedalia Police took a burglary report in the 300 block of E. 17th. The total amount of items taken in the incident was $11,081. The burglary happened between 6 p.m. Tuesday and 1 p.m. Wednesday, it was noted.


 

Sedalia Police arrested two people at 7:22 a.m. Wednesday at 4th and Beacon after officers were called to the area on a report of an assault. Taken into custody were 20-year-old Barry J. Monteer, Jr., and 18-year-old Tatiana L. Monroy, both of Pettis County. Monteer was charged with 3rd Degree Assault and Monroy was charged with 4th Degree Assault.
